DetailsCosts are accumulated for each of these batches and summarized into a cost pool, which is then divided by the number of units produced to arrive at the unit product cost. The usual contents of this cost pool are the total direct material and direct labor costs of a batch, as well as a factory overhead allocation. How to Calculate Unit …

DetailsIt is important to choke feed the crusher, keeping the crushing chamber at full capacity. Trickle feeding results in uneven wear and poor output. You also need a mix of large and small stones in the chamber; uniform size leads to wear and waste. To ensure good shape, feed a long fraction (5-32 mm) into the crusher to aid inter-particle breakage.
